Patch Notes 2.4.3

General

  • Dispel effects will no longer attempt to remove effects that have 100% dispel resistance.
  • Parry Rating, Defense Rating, and Block Rating: Low-level players will now convert these ratings into their corresponding defensive stats at the same rate as level 34 players.
  • Haris Pilton has launched a new line of bags and jewelry. Check her out in the World’s End Tavern!
  • Mounts at 30?! Yes, it’s true: Apprentice Riding and mounts are now available at level 30. Training costs 35 gold.
  • Blood Elf flightmasters outside of Silvermoon City and Tranquillien have traded in their bats for glorious fire-breathing dragonhawks.
  • Alcohol cooldowns have been rolled into Drinks: All 10-second cooldowns have been removed and replaced with the 1-second Drink cooldown.
  • Numerous flying non-combat pets have had their flight height modified to no longer skim along the ground: captured firefly, dragonhawk hatchlings, moths, owls, parrots, phoenix hatchling, spirit of summer, sprite darter, and tiny sporebat.
  • Nether Ray Fry (a non-combat pet) is now available from the Skyguard Quartermaster. This requires an Exalted reputation with Sha’tari Skyguard.
  • Equipping an item will now cancel any spell cast currently in progress.
  • Placing an item in your bank will now cancel any spell cast currently in progress if the spell was cast by that item.
  • You can no longer move backwards to stop racing rams.
  • When a stun wears off, the creature that was stunned will prefer the last target with the highest threat, versus the current target.

Dreamstate Druid/Rogue 2v2

This a very popular combo in 2v2 brackets, and can achieve high team & personal ratings. Top team in season 3 is I warned you dodging sux with 2675 team rating at Misery Battlegroup (EU). This is the part 1 of the guide, some matchups you’ll find bellow:

vs Paladin/Warrior

Splitting Paladin and Warrior is the key to win this team. The rogue goes on the Paladin stunlocking him as much as possible and interrupting his heals. The druid has to chase the warrior and bring him on the opposite side of the map, far enough from the paladin. Then he must start doing dmg to him. A nice chain of Cyclone/Starfire/moonfire/Insect swarm and Entangle Roots/Starfire/Moonfire/Insect swarm will do the job. Then the paladin has to heal 2 targets and he’s not good at it. When bubble is on cd or Well timed cyclones on warrioris when the pally bubbles, it’s a win.

vs Mage/Rogue

This is a hard matchup. This match mostly depends on your enemies’ experience against your team. Nevertheless you should have equal chances against this team at least.

You start with a Sap on the Rogue (if your Rogue is Human) and then try to stick to the Mage. The important thing against this combination is that the Mage doesn’t get any Sheeps off. If your Rogue gets one sheep on him and he has already used his Insignia the Mage/Rogue team will switch on your Druid and will kill him.

You can counter their tactic with an extremely offensive one of your own. When their Rogue is Sapped and your Rogue is on the Mage your Druid should start damaging the Mage as well. Your Druid should use Moon Fire/Insect Swarm/Wrath/Wrath combinations. When the Sap is almost over, your Druid should Faerie Fire the Rogue so that he can’t Vanish immediately. If he does and he has no Cloak of Shadows left he will be vulnerable to more CC. If you put out lots of pressure at the beginning (your Druid needs to know when to stop casting, in order not to get a 8 second Counter Spell because in which 8 seconds he/his mate would die). The Mage should normally use his Block very early. At this time Vanish and prepare to rush down the mage the second time. If your Rogue can’t vanish that’s not a problem either. One rogue alone can’t do much to you/your Rogue.

vs Druid/Warrior

Generally you try to find the Druid, before the Shadow Sight buff pops. If you can’t find their Druid (which shouldn’t happen when playing with a Human Rogue) you must start on the Warrior. The Rogue starts with a sap on the Warrior, the Druid start with a Starfire/Moonfire/Insect Swarm combo along with your Rogue’s opening Cheap Shot. The Warrior should drop fast, so that their Druid needs to pop out to heal. The key here is to Cyclone the Warrior when he gets the first HoT of the opponent druid, and then switch to him. Through the whole fight you should try to keep the Warrior crowd controlled with Cyclone/Roots nearly all the time, while assisting your Rogue with dps. If your Rogue can stay on the Druid, their druid will always be out of mana before you (you’re a dreamstate remember?). If they do then you should win.

Arena season 4 on 24-25th of June

We have super hot news today. Eyonix, Blizzard poster, announced that season 4 starts at 24th of June (25th of June for European players):

We’re currently planning to end the third Arena season and begin Arena Season 4 on June 24, 2008. This exciting Arena season will introduce the Brutal Gladiator set, and will also allow players to purchase Arena Season 2 items using the honor system. Please note that we will be resetting all Arena team and personal ratings. Players will still retain their Arena points and teams with this reset. The team and personal rating will simply be reset to the default 1500, allowing all teams to once again compete for top honors with a fresh start.

Also, with the end of the third season, players on the top teams from each battlegroup will receive their end-of-season rewards. These include Arena-specific titles that they can display proudly until the end of the new season, and, for the best of the best, an Armored Nether Drake. Please also be aware that with the end of the current season, all previous end-of-season titles will be removed.

Righteous Defense Macro

Righteous DefenceAs you might know, the righteous defence ability of Tankadins works a bit different with the taunt/growl ability of Warriors and Feral Dudus. A macro for it, is highly recommended!

#showtooltip
/cast [target=mouseover,help,nodead][help,nodead][target=targettarget,help,nodead] Righteous Defense;

If you click the button of the above macro, the paladin casts Righteous Defence to the mouseover friendly target or the targeted friendly target or finally to the target of your unfriendly target.

A simpler and most useful version of the above macro is the following:

#showtooltip
/cast [help,nodead][target=targettarget,help,nodead] Righteous Defense;

Protection Paladin Gear - Head Slot

Recently the time i spend in World of Warcraft is limited, basically because of my exams and the lack of interest in PVP as I got my Vengeful Shoulders. I found respeccing to Tankadin a nice idea. I will guide you what is your best choices for each slot based on uncrushability values

Head Slot
Faceplate of the Impenetrable
Drops from Illidan Stormrage in Black Temple. 7,72% (Defence/Dodge/Block)

Faceguard of Determination
Costs 50 Badge of Justice. 6,48% (Defence/Dodge/Block)

Crown of Dath’Remar
Token From Sunwell Plateau. 6,36% (Defence/Dodge/Parry)

Hard Khorium Goggles
BoP Craft from 375 Engineering. 5,30% (Defence/Dodge)

Helm of Uther’s Resolve
Token From Sunwell Plateau. 4,33% (Defence/Dodge)

Crystalforge Faceguard
T5 Token from Serpentshrine Caverns. 4,30% (Defence/Block)

Faceguard of the Endless Watch
Drops from Doomwalker, world boss. 3,98% (Defence/Dodge)

Battleworn Tuskguard
Drops from Hex Lord Malacrass from Zul’aman. 3,92% (Dodge/Block)

Lightbringer Faceguard
T6 token from Hyjal Summit. 3,85% (Defence/Dodge)

Tankatronic Goggles
BoP Craft from 350 Engineering. 3,73% (Defence/Dodge)

Justicar Faceguard
T4 Token from Karazhan. 3,23% (Defence/Dodge)

Reinforced Heaume
Quest item from Master Smith Rhonsus. 2,51% (Defence/Agility)

Eternium Greathelm
Drops from Opera Event. 2,30% (Defence)

Felsteel Helm
BoE craft from 365 Blacksmithing. 2,23% (Defence)

Myrmidon’s Headdress
Quest item from The Warlord’s Hideout. 2,23% (Defence)

Warhelm of the Bold
Drops from Warp Splinter in Botanica. 2,19% (Defence/Agility)

Greathelm of the Unbreakable
Drops from Grand Warlock Nethekurse in Shattered Halls. 2,03% (Defence)

Horns of the Illidari
Quest item from Subdue the Subduer. 1,96% (Defence)

Wildguard Helm
BoE Craft from 375 Blacksmithing. 1,89% (Defence)

Helm of the Stalwart Defender
BoE Craft from 365 Blacksmithing. 1,56% (Defence)

Helm of the Righteous
Drops from Pathaleon the Calculator in The Mechanar. 1,42% (Defence)

Iceguard Helm
BoE Craft from 375 Blacksmithing. 1,35% (Defence)

Protectorate Headplate
Quest item from Delivering the Message. 1,27% (Parry/Agility)

X-52 Technician’s Helm
Quest item from Back to the thief! 1,08% (Defence)

Oathkeeper’s Helm
365 Blacksmithing. 1,01% (Defence)

Leotheras the Blind

LeotherasHe’s the 3rd boss in Serpentshrine Cavern with 3,700,000 hit points and 221 gold wealth.

Abilities

Human Form

  • Whirlwind: Leotheras will spin around the room in a fashion similar to the Battleguard Sartura encounter in Ahn’Qiraj. This ability deals direct damage and leaves a bleed dot. Leotheras resets all aggro after the whirlwind.

Demon Form

  • Insidious Whisper: Debuff that summons an Inner Demon from up to five raid members. Each Inner Demon can be attacked only by the person it spawned from. If you do not kill your Inner Demon before Leotheras gets back into humanoid form you will become Mind Controlled for 10 minutes and can’t get out of it unless killed. Inner Demons take increased damage from arcane, nature, and holy spells.
  • Chaos Blast: Chaos Blast is Leotheras’ only form of attacking while in demon form. It is a single target nuke that deals AoE damage around the target. Chaos Blast also leaves a stacking debuff that increases fire damage taken.
